Financial Times reports the Trump administration has paid roughly $100 billion in tariff refunds since the US Supreme Court ruled its use of emergency powers to impose tariffs on trade partners invalid. US Customs told a judge at the US Court of International Trade on Tuesday the refunds equal about 60% of the $165 billion collected under the president’s emergency tariffs.
